comp.lang.ada
 help / color / mirror / Atom feed
From: John Perry <devotus@yahoo.com>
Subject: Re: GtkAda's "On_Edited"
Date: Tue, 31 May 2022 20:18:29 -0700 (PDT)	[thread overview]
Message-ID: <409bb984-2e7f-45e6-a5c1-7b637bec2c22n@googlegroups.com> (raw)
In-Reply-To: <t7342i$1set$1@gioia.aioe.org>

On Monday, May 30, 2022 at 1:57:30 PM UTC-5, Dmitry A. Kazakov wrote:
> > In the end I made it work with an On_* design...
> If that is OK to you, but in production code you need a lot of stuff to 
> do in a handler, most of it is unrelated to the tree view.

I agree with what you write, and learned a bit. I've never been in a situation where I had to implement a TreeView-like object before, so I never had to think about it much. I probably won't pursue it since the project I'm working on is a small, personal project with corresponding amounts of time available.

> BTW, derived widgets is also a GtkAda feature, in GTK a derived widget 
> require a lot of work. In GtkAda they are trivial.

Interesting! I'll probably look into this more at some future point.

thanks again
john perry

      reply	other threads:[~2022-06-01  3:18 UTC|newest]

Thread overview: 5+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2022-05-30  5:28 GtkAda's "On_Edited" John Perry
2022-05-30  6:47 ` Dmitry A. Kazakov
2022-05-30  7:46   ` John Perry
2022-05-30 18:57     ` Dmitry A. Kazakov
2022-06-01  3:18       ` John Perry [this message]
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ox